CESS Network is a decentralized storage network built for AI, cloud computing, and data sovereignty.
The CESS Network is an ecosystem for decentralized data infrastructure that aims to create a new-generation solution for storage, data delivery, and AI-compatible cloud computing services. This decentralized blockchain project is developed as a layer-1 ecosystem, which integrates decentralized storage, Content-Decentralized Delivery Network (CD²N), data sovereignty, data privacy solutions, and infrastructure for AI purposes to help enterprises, developers, and decentralized apps operate on the Internet. The technology is supported by its proprietary blockchain and integrates decentralized storage, content delivery, smart contract capabilities, cloud computing services, and advanced data solutions dedicated to AI applications into one ecosystem
| Year | Key Achievements |
| 2019 – 2020 | The core CESS technical team came together to solve problems in centralized cloud storage. |
| A multi-layer decentralized network architecture was completed, and early prototypes were tested. | |
| The team defined the base frameworks for key protocols like Random Rotational Selection (R²S) consensus, Multi-format Data Rights Confirmation (MDRC), and Proof of Data Reduplication and Recovery (PoDR²). | |
| 2021 | The CESS White Paper v0.1 was published, and the public testnet v0.1 went live. |
| The project secured 1st place at the Polkadot APAC Hackathon, confirming its direction as a Substrate-based chain built for cross-chain systems. | |
| 2022 | Testnet moved through multiple upgrades from v0.1.2 to v0.6. |
| Decentralized Object Storage Service (DeOSS) was launched, enabling fast Web3 data access at near-Web2 speeds. | |
| 2023 | Testnet continued to evolve up to v0.7.5, with the network surpassing 1,100 active storage nodes. |
| In December 2023, CESS raised $8 million in Series A funding from DWF Labs, HTX Ventures, Infinity Ventures Crypto, and the Web3 Foundation. | |
| 2024 | The team launched the DeCloud v1.0 disk app and began shifting focus toward decentralized science (DeSci) and AI-driven data infrastructure. |
| 2025 | Final code audits were completed as the project prepared for the Mainnet launch after the last testnet phases. |
| CESS developed CESS AI-LINK, a developer toolkit that lets AI agents and LLMs directly access decentralized data pools. | |
| A point-to-token redemption system was introduced for early testnet miners, along with preparations for the Token Generation Event (TGE) of the native token ($CESS). |
